Chickamauga Connector Trail
Chickamauga Connector Trail Welcome to the Chickamauga Connector Trail, a historical park located in the heart of Chickamauga, Georgia. Situated at the crossroads of history and natural beauty, our park offers visitors an opportunity to explore the rich past of this pivotal region. In 1863, the Battle of Chickamauga marked a significant moment in American history as Union and Confederate forces clashed over the strategic city of Chattanooga, known as the "Gateway to the Deep South." Though the Confederates claimed victory at Chickamauga in September, subsequent battles in Chattanooga led to a decisive Union win, signaling a turning point in the Civil War. A Confederate soldier poignantly remarked, "This...is the death-knell of the Confederacy."

Monument to 3rd Wisconsin Battery - Van Cleve's Division
Welcome to the Monument to the 3rd Wisconsin Battery - Van Cleve's Division, a historic landmark located in Chickamauga, Georgia. Situated amidst the serene beauty of the Chickamauga and Chattanooga National Military Park, this monument commemorates the valor and sacrifice of the 3rd Wisconsin Battery during the pivotal Battle of Chickamauga in 1863. In September of that year, Union and Confederate forces clashed in a fierce battle for control of Chattanooga, known as the "Gateway to the Deep South." Although the Confederates emerged victorious at Chickamauga, their triumph was short-lived as Union forces reclaimed victory and control of Chattanooga in November. This turning point in the Civil War marked a significant shift, leading a Confederate soldier to ominously declare, "This...is the death-knell of the Confederacy."
